Title: | NISP thermal control design justification file | Authors: | MORGANTE, GIANLUCA | Issue Date: | 2014 | Number: | EUCL-IBO-RP-7-004 | Abstract: | The NISP Thermal Control (NI-TC) system is composed by all the passive and active units that contribute to the definition and maintenance of the NISP thermal status. Its main task is to control the Instrument temperatures at interfaces and subsystems level within the thermal requirement ranges, both in operational and non-operational conditions. In this document we describe the justification of the NISP Thermal Control system design. | URI: | http://hdl.handle.net/20.500.12386/33468 | Fulltext: | reserved |
